Theft
DEFINED EVENTS
THEFT
Loss of or damage to all contents (the property of the Insured or for which they are legally responsible) of any insured building(s) at the insured premises described in the Schedule as a result of theft (or any attempt thereat) accompanied by visible signs of physical damage from such building as a result of the forcible and violent entry or exit.
The Insured shall be responsible for the first 10% (ten percent) with a minimum of R750 (seven hundred and fifty rand) in respect of each and every claim or the amount stated in the Schedule.
The Company will also pay for loss or damage to property as a result of:
1. Losses caused or accompanied by:
1.1 a thief or thieves being concealed upon the insured premises before close of business;
1.2 entry to and/or exit from the premises being effected by use of a skeleton key or other similar device (excluding a duplicate key);
PROVIDED THAT:
the Insured shall establish to the satisfaction of the Company that such a skeleton key or device was used.
2. Losses whilst in a building at any additional premises:
PROVIDED THAT:
1. such additional premises are advised to the Company within 30 (thirty) days from the time the risk attaches to the Company;
2. an additional premium, if any, is paid;
3. the Company’s liability in respect of this Extension shall not exceed 50% (fifty percent) of the highest amount stated in the Schedule applicable to any one premises.
3. Damage to buildings
Damage to the buildings including landlord's fixtures and fittings whether inside the buildings or attached to the outside of the buildings at the insured premises in the course of theft or any attempt thereat;
PROVIDED THAT:
the Company will not be liable to pay more than R10 000 (ten thousand rand) per event.
4. Additional costs
The Company will also pay for costs incurred but excluding any amount recoverable under any other Provision or Section in respect of:
4.1 loss of buildings, landlord's fixtures and fittings at the insured premises as a result of theft (or any attempt thereat) accompanied by visible signs of physical damage from such building as a result of the forcible and violent entry or exit;
4.2 temporary repairs in respect of all reasonable costs and expenses in effecting such temporary repairs and in taking such temporary measures as may be reasonably necessary after loss or damage;
PROVIDED THAT:
1. the Company shall not be liable to pay more than R10 000 (ten thousand rand) in the aggregate each and every event;
2. the Insured shall be responsible for the first R750 (seven hundred and fifty rand) in respect of each and every claim.
